HIP 14687

HIP 14687 is a F-type (Yellow-White) star located in the constellation Cassiopeia.

Located approximately 450.5 light-years from Earth, HIP 14687 resides within the broader disk of our Milky Way galaxy.

HIP 14687 is classified as a spectral class F star (F-type (Yellow-White)) on the Harvard spectral classification system.

HIP 14687 has an apparent magnitude of +8.94, placing it beyond naked-eye visibility. A good pair of binoculars or a small telescope is required to observe this star. Observers will note its yellow-white hue, which corresponds to a B-V color index of +0.680.
